Lawyer: Let us start with the procedure now. The first step towards your brother's SIV approval is, “petition”. We will be filling a petition with USCIS (Nebraska Service Center). To file this petition, we need a form I- 360, which can be downloaded from the official web portal of USCIS. Along with this application, we need to annex few other documents such as:
Copy of your brother's ...
... passport (Date of Birth and Nationality Proofs with translations, if not in English)
Work proofs – documentation evidencing that your brother served the cited departments (Mentioned in Part 1)
Evidence of Background check – conducted by US Armed Force or COM.
Letter of Recommendation – as mentioned in Part 1 (Letter from General in the Army, Air Force, or Marine Corps; Admiral, Rear Admiral in the Navy; or the Chief of Mission in Baghdad or Kabul.
Client:Is there any particular format for “letter of recommendation?”
Lawyer: No, there is no such format, but the letter must mention below cited things:
The tenure of your brother's service
Information concerning his security clearance
And last but not least, the recommendation
Client: A friend of mine told me that the postal address has to be an American Address. Why is it so?
Lawyer:The USCIS department cannot send mails outside America, so postal address must be an American one. It would be better, if you can take care of your brothers' mails.
Client: After approval, what is next?
Lawyer: After the USCIS Nebraska Service Center is done with its assessments, they will forward his approval to NVC and then NVC will revert back with the visa status update.
